摘要
The cam profile is often produced by milling with a bevelled face mill (6) having the axis (7) inclined by the amount of the bevel angle. Two-controlled feed motions, one rotational about the cam axis (4) and the other normal to the cam axis in the direction (11) are applied to produce the cam profile. It can be shown that the cam surface deviates from parallelism with the cam axis (4). Greater accuracy can be achieved by providing a further controlled feed axis in the direction normal to the plane of the cam axis (4) and the cutter axis (7). USE/ADVANTAGE - Mfr. of LC engine and other machinery. Cams with a wider face can be accurately produced.
